New fields of high power inverter systems such like hybrid cars, hybrid trucks, and off road vehicles require new ways of power electronics integration and packaging. The stringent requirements in size and weight, reliability, durability, ambient temperature, and environment can be fulfilled by a careful consideration of IGBT and diode chip selection, novel packaging technologies and consequent integration of passive components. In this paper the authors will discuss how the environmental conditions of automotive applications drive silicon power device selection and packaging technologies. Extreme cooling conditions require a package design that needs to work on the thermal and electrical limits of the components without making any compromise in reliability and durability. A high power Integrated Inverter Module (MM) for 600 V, 150 kVA, integrating all necessary system components in a single package, has been realized.
